Exodus 36:13-15
New American Standard Bible
Chapter 36
13
He also made fifty clasps of gold, and joined the curtains to one another with the clasps, so that the tabernacle was a unit.
14
Then he made curtains of goats’
hair
for a tent over the tabernacle; he made eleven curtains
in all.
15
The length of each curtain
was
thirty cubits, and four cubits
was
the width of each curtain; the eleven curtains had the same measurements.
